Qwest Permit Consolidation - Pleasant Grove Ranger District
The Qwest Communications dba Century Link provided GIS data sets and excel spreadsheets to the Uinta-Wasatch-Cache N.F. displaying the location of all telecommunication lines they believe located on NFS lands.
Project Summary
Location Summary:
Lines are located along previously disturbed roadways and/or trails in Provo Canyon, South Fork Canyon, American Fork Canyon and the mouth of Rock Canyon.
